Sports ministry disclaims diverting funds for basketball players
The Federal Ministry of Youth and Sports Development has responded to allegations implying its officials have misappropriated funds meant for the payment of bonuses and allowances of players and officials of the country’s basketball teams.
This was made known in a press statement signed by Ismaila Abubakar, Permanent Secretary, Federal Ministry of Youth and Sports Development released on Wednesday.
According to the statement, the secretary made an attempt to explain the reasons for the delay while an order for prompt payments was also made.

Federal Ministry of Youth and Sports Development Denies Allegations its Officials Shared Basketballers’ Monies, Donations intact in CBN account of the NBBF.
The Federal Ministry of Youth and Sports Development has denied allegations made in a press statement used in a section of the media and in a video clip that its officials shared some monies donated to the Men and Women Basketball Teams ahead of the Tokyo 2020 Olympics.
The Ministry wishes to make the following clarifications:
1. The $230,000 Dollars donated to the Basketball teams by the Banks under the Adopt-a-Team programme of the Ministry is intact in the Nigeria Basketball Federation’s (NBBF) official domiciliary account domiciled with the Central Bank of Nigeria (CBN).
2. That only the 12 female Team members of D’Tigress have supplied their foreign account numbers. The Ministry waited for the account numbers of the Male Team to be supplied so that the processing of payments can be one-off as requested by the CBN.
3. The Ministry has requested the CBN to commence the processing of the payment to the Female Basketball Players immediately. The Male will be paid as soon as their account details are supplied.
4. The Ministry wishes to state further that all outstanding -Olympics and Paralympics Games allowances and bonuses are being processed and only slowed down by funds availability.
Furthermore, the Ministry of Finance has been fully furnished with details of the outstanding allowances and payments due to the NBBF and the Nigeria Football Federation (NFF) and efforts are being made to secure the release.

Background Story: ‘How Nigerian Officials Diverted $100,000 Meant For Women Basketball Team…’
On Tuesday, 12th of October, 2021, Sahara reporter reported how officials of the Federal Ministry of Youth and Sports diverted $100,000 meant for the women basketball team, D’Tigress, Owe each player $4,900 allowances.
Speaking with SaharaReporters, a member of the senior women basketball team, D’Tigress, revealed that their allowances, bonuses, training grant worth $4,900 had also not been paid.
She added that none of the D’Tigress team members would show up in a camp in preparation for the February 2022 FIBA World Cup if the Nigerian government failed to pay them.
